About Carbon Streaming Corporation

https://www.carbonstreaming.com/

Carbon Streaming Corporation specializes in accelerating global climate action by pioneering and utilizing stream financing to scale high-integrity carbon credit projects worldwide. The company provides upfront capital to project developers through streaming, royalty, or royalty-like arrangements in exchange for the future delivery of a set number of carbon offset credits. This proven and flexible funding model supports projects that advance the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als. The resulting high-quality carbon credits are a key instrument used by governments and corporations to meet climate targets. Furthermore, Carbon Streaming operates as an ESG principled investment vehicle, offering investors direct exposure to the global voluntary and compliance carbon markets.
